Original Description
Qiu Ying's Untitled painting transports viewers to a serene Ming dynasty garden, where delicate brushstrokes breathe life into lush landscapes and scholarly elegance. As one of the "Four Masters of the Ming Dynasty," Qiu Ying perfected the gongbi style – his meticulous detailing in architecture, flowing robes, and natural elements creates a harmonious balance between humanity and nature. The work exemplifies the literati tradition, blending poetic symbolism with technical precision, where winding pathways invite contemplation and blossoming plum trees whisper of resilience. Though undated, this piece likely belongs to Qiu Ying's mature period when his fame as a court painter soared, bridging professional artistry with philosophical depth. Art historians treasure such works as cultural touchstones, revealing how Ming dynasty artists reinterpreted classical Song compositions through jewel-like colors and intricate narratives, making them pivotal in understanding China's artistic evolution.
